Beautifully renovated craftsman in the heart of Oklahoma City.
Our 100 year old home has been remodeled with modern day amenities while maintaining its historic charm. Close to Downtown, Midtown, Bricktown, Paseo District, Plaza District, and OU Medical Hospital, with easy access to the interstates. There are several amazing restaurants and parks within walking distance. Enjoy the outdoor living spaces in the front and back of the home. Sit on the front porch swing while taking in a sunset with a view of the downtown skyline. The back yard has a large wooden deck, dining table, fire pit, grill, ect.
